我使用em标签在图像上写一些文本.我想提供某种功能,例如,当用户在文本框中键入内容时,该文本将覆盖图像.我怀疑应该将哪个事件侦听器添加到文本框中,以便一旦更改文本框的内容,它也可以更改图像的内容.我只需要知道可以使用事件侦听器完成此操作,还是需要更多操作.我知道如何更改图像中的文本,但找不到如何动态更新此图像文本.希望问题清楚解决方法:这是使用纯JavaScript的另一种替代方法. 在文本框中添加onkeyup并调用您提供的函数...
如果我要调用pushState但要保留所有相对链接,图像,样式表等,那么到目前为止,我会执行以下操作:$('[href]').each(function() { if (!/^#/.test(this.href)) this.href = this.href; }); $('[src]').each(function() { this.src = this.src });我的问题是:这可以跨浏览器工作吗?我需要做$(this).attr(‘href’)= this.href吗? 这有必要吗?还有另一种方法吗?这是最好的方法吗?而且它总是可以正常工作吗?解决方法:pushState更改...
是否可以使用间隔更新它?我努力了:var timers = require("timers"); var pageMod = require("page-mod"); var mystyle = ....;function func1(){ pageMod.PageMod({include: "*.org",contentScript: mystyle }); } func1();function func2(){mysyle = http://...... }timers.setInterval(func2,10000);问题是它将在每个间隔开始两次注册pageMod.假设我有mystyle的内部内容:alert(“ hello world”);因此,我将转到某个页面,在刷新...
我正在使用其id将文本区域值(十进制数字)收集到一个javascript变量,添加另一个变量值(十进制数字),并在同一html页面中显示结果 文字区号:<div class="input-resp"><span><input class="textbox" id="num" name="count" type="text" size="5" maxlength="3" value="" /></span></div>将值传递给var并将其添加到另一个varvar a = document.getElementById('num').value; var b = 1000; var c = parseFloat(a) + parseFloat(b); 将...
有没有办法用陨石更新单个智能包装? 很长的故事: 我正在开发一个使用要维护的智能软件包的应用程序.我希望能够快速对软件包进行实时更改并更新应用程序使用的版本,而无需检查所有可能的更新,例如使用mrt update完成时.我知道我可以先使用mrt remove软件包,然后再使用mrt add软件包,但是由于存在多个依赖关系,因此这不太可行.有没有快速简便的方法?解决方法:我认为最简单的方法是在/ packages中使用硬包.您可以从github下载所需的...
我创建了下面的这个JSFiddle:http://jsfiddle.net/qTLmV/ 这是我正在使用的CSS:.nested > .addable-group > div.active:nth-of-type(even) {background: blue; }.nested > .addable-group > div.active:nth-of-type(odd) {background: grey; }简化的布局:<div class="nested"><div class="addable-group"><div class="active"><a href="#">remove 1</a></div><div class="active"><a href="#">remove 2</a></div><div class="ac...
我有一个包含1000多个行(用户)和一个检查列的网格,该网格用于将每个用户链接到另一个特定实例(例如一组用户).我实现了一个“全选”按钮,它可以执行以下操作:var items = view.store.data.items;var dataIndex = 'dataIndexOfCheckColumn';var check = true;//view.store.suspendEvents();for (var i = 0; i < items.length; i++){var record = view.store.getAt(i),record.set(dataIndex, check);this.fireEvent('checkchange', t...
我有一个UserServiceangular.module('mango.services', []).factory('UserService', function() {var user = {id: null,name: 'anonymous.'};function getUser(){return user;}function setUser(val){user = val;}return {getUser: getUser,setUser: setUser,} });NavbarController.controller('NavbarController', ['$scope','$location','UserService', function($scope, $location, UserService){$scope.isActive = function (v...
至少在Firefox中,当在动态或用户更改的textarea或select元素上使用cloneNode(true)时,不会保留value属性(也不更改DOM来反映动态更改),而对于input元素,则更改为value属性或由用户反映在DOM中(因此在调用cloneNode时将其保留).为什么会有这种区别? 更新: >我想问:规范中是否规定了这种行为? (或在错误报告中详细说明?)>样本位于:http://jsfiddle.net/9RSNt/1/解决方法:我怀疑这种差异的产生是因为textarea和selects的值由它们...
我有一个角度指令esResize,在隔离范围上使用双向绑定时遇到问题.window.estimation.directive('esResize', function() {return {restrict:'C',scope: {pointGrid: '='},template: "<h2>{{ pointGrid }}</h2><ul><li ng-repeat='card in pointGrid track by $id(card)'>{{ card }}</li></ul>",controller: function($scope) {$scope.shiftTicket = function() {$scope.pointGrid.push("New Ticket");};},link: function(scope, elem...
我的页面上有几个列表,请参见下面的示例<div id="test1" class="testlist"><ul><li title="test" data-view="0">Any</li><li title="test" data-view="101">list item 101</li><li title="test" data-view="102">list item 102</li><li title="test" data-view="103">list item 103</li><li title="test" data-view="104">list item 104</li><li title="test" data-view="105">list item 105</li><li title="test" data-view="106"...
来自Python / Java / PHP,我现在正在建立一个网站.我希望在其上近乎实时地更新项目列表:如果将项目(服务器端)添加到列表中或从列表中删除,则应在网页上进行更新.我做了一个简单的API调用,现在我每秒轮询一次,以使用jQuery更新列表.因为我需要在同一页面上保持更多列表更新,所以我担心这将导致每个打开的浏览器每秒超过10个服务器调用,即使没有更新. 这似乎不合逻辑,但我真的不知道该怎么做.我查看了Meteor,但是由于要构建的网页是...
我想打破用户输入到内容可编辑容器中的文本,并用包裹在< span>中的相同文本替换容器的内容.元素. 这是我的渲染方法:render: function() {var children = [],index = 0;this.state.tokens.forEach(function(token) {children.push(<span key={index++}>{token}</span>, <span key={index++}> </span>);});return <div ref="input"className="input" contentEditable="true" onKeyPress={this.keyPress}>{children}</div>; }(entire...
我有一个表格,可以让用户输入一些文本,并在用户提交表格时输入.返回该文本,并使用该文本的PIL模块生成图像.@app.route('/enter') def index():img = Image.new('RGB',(1000,1000))txt=request.form['text']font=ImageFont.truetype("ariel.ttf",30)draw = ImageDraw.Draw ( img )draw.text ( ( 0 , 0), txt, font=font, fill="#000000" )io = StringIO()img.save(io, format='png')data = io.getvalue().encode('base64')return ...
<div id="resultperpage"><span><a>12</a></span><span><a>24</a></span><span><a>48</a></span><span><a>98</a></span> </div>$('#resultperpage span').click(function() {$('#resultperpage span').html($(?).html() + 'A')); });<div id="resultperpage"><span><a>12A</a></span><span><a>24A</a></span><span><a>48A</a></span><span><a>98A</a></span> </div>请帮助我替换jQuery函数中的问号,以便输出为文本“ A”解决方法:您...